
ICN Best Practices for the Assessment of Unilateral Conduct
ICN Best Practices for the Assessment of Unilateral Conduct provide guidelines for how competition authorities evaluate whether a company's behavior harms competition. They suggest a balanced approach, considering the company's market power, reasons for the conduct, and its impact on competitors and consumers. Authorities should analyze if the conduct excludes competitors unfairly or leads to higher prices or reduced choices for consumers. The goal is to promote fair competition while respecting legitimate business strategies. These best practices aim to ensure consistent, transparent, and objective assessments across different jurisdictions.
